Output 8c4a35488ea131013cdea8361113e6c1213a564b12a33b39f1702f03034ee357:1

value
1540963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ea61aea3e5425605c07c654c38b6414ce5ff526a OP_EQUAL
address
3P4K4WWDyNtdqUi62pWnTMm51sYrqxp4Wa
transaction
8c4a35488ea131013cdea8361113e6c1213a564b12a33b39f1702f03034ee357
confirmations
401368
spent
true